A strategic Indo-China border post, Nathula Pass is a thrilling destination in Sikkim. At 14,140 feet, it offers breathtaking views of the Tibetan plateau and an opportunity to experience sub-zero temperatures. Indian tourists can visit the border post with a special permit, making it a unique and adventurous experience. The pass was once part of the ancient Silk Route, which connected India with Tibet, adding a historical charm to its allure.
